TICKET — Missed pick-up, Halvern Print Works. Crate of museum labels for the new Tidemark Gallery wing was not collected this morning. Driver never arrived; Halvern closes at 16:00. Labels are needed for install tomorrow, no slack. Rebook for first slot today, any available van. Confirm driver name back to this ticket. Tell the driver the dock is on Ferring Lane, rear entrance only. Hand-over instruction follows below.

handover note for yagef-bagep: the drudor pelius courier leaves the kasdor zorvan norir ledger at gate 8016 under passcode 755406

# Service Accounts — ProctorQueue Plugin Access

External plugins talk to the ProctorQueue intake API through a shared plugin service account. The account can enqueue and poll exam sessions but cannot modify verdicts. Rate limits apply per plugin. Sandbox testing is mandatory before certification. Authenticate sandbox requests with the key below.

API key for yahig-tadup: kto7_ubizbYm

To plugin authors: the user-profile store is moving from a single primary to eight hash-based shards over the next two releases. Your plugins should stop assuming global transactions across profiles; cross-shard writes will be rejected once the cutover completes. Reads remain transparent through the router, so lookups by user key need no changes. Batch scans must switch to the per-shard iterator API. Test against the dual-write environment before the freeze. The router settings your integration tests should use are given below.

settings of fafog-haduf:
ZORIX_PIN=4648
ZORIX_METRICS_HOST=metrics.zorix.paliqsys.corp
ZORIX_LOG_LEVEL=info
ZORIX_TENANT=druix